In a dramatic turn of events on EastEnders, the murder trial of Jasmine Fisher takes center stage, sending shockwaves through Walford and confirming a potential double exit that could reshape the community forever. As tensions escalate between the Slaters and the Truemans, the fallout from the trial threatens to tear families apart, with lives hanging in the balance.

Jasmine's Fate and Family Divisions

At the heart of the turmoil is Jasmine Fisher, accused of killing her father, as her trial commences and her future remains uncertain. The pressure mounts not only on Jasmine but also on those around her, with the Truemans and Slaters firmly divided, each bracing for the impending verdict. This familial conflict sets the stage for explosive developments that could lead to permanent changes in Walford.

Bombshell Revelations and Exit Plans

A major twist unfolds when Sandra drops a bombshell, revealing to Denise, Yolande, Chelsea, and Kim that she and Josh have been offered a fresh start in Southend, a plan kept secret from Jasmine and Zoe Slater. Zoe, who has only recently reconnected with her son, faces the devastating news that Josh might leave again, adding to the emotional turmoil. Whether Jasmine is found guilty or cleared, the damage to relationships may already be irreparable, pushing Josh closer to a permanent departure.

Courtroom Drama and Desperate Moves

Back in court, the pressure intensifies as Jasmine's lawyer, Ritchie Scott, grows concerned that a character statement from Patrick Trueman could sway the case against Jasmine. In a desperate bid, Ritchie urges Kat Moon to provide a statement, but Kat initially refuses, torn about getting involved. However, Zoe's fear that Josh will abandon the family if Jasmine is convicted forces Kat to reconsider, despite the risk of straining her fragile relationship with Zoe further.

Determined to uncover the truth, Kat tracks down Sandra to investigate Jasmine's past, learning details about her upbringing that could significantly impact the trial. Meanwhile, Josh grapples with his loyalties, caught between Patrick and Jasmine, and makes a bold decision to visit his sister for the truth.

Jasmine's Impossible Choice and Verdict Fallout

As the trial progresses, Jasmine faces an impossible decision: to stand up in court and give her own statement or plead guilty for a shorter sentence, a choice that will define her life. The long-awaited verdict is finally read out, revealing Jasmine's fate, but the drama is far from over. In The Vic, Kat makes a bold declaration, seeking a way forward after the chaos.

With Sandra and Josh planning their move to Southend and the trial's outcome set to alter everything, Walford could bid farewell to two familiar faces. This trial doesn't just decide Jasmine's fate; it reverberates through the entire community, leaving lasting scars and uncertain futures for all involved.
